Spotlight on Introducing VAT in HE module

21 April 2020      Amanda Darley, Head of Operations and Engagement

This week we’re highlighting the Introducing VAT in HE BUFDG Pro module. While it might sound like this is a module confined to use by VAT specialists in central finance teams, that isn’t actually the case.

This module was designed for all those throughout a university who have to deal with financial issues such as budgeting, purchasing or generating income, to help them understand the VAT implications of their financial decision making.

In particular, it is aimed at:

  • school/department administrators, and other administrative and finance staff based in academic departments who are not VAT experts but have to deal with VAT as part of their role e.g. dealing with departmental budgets, raising POs, coding invoices etc.
  • academic staff who need to consider VAT and budgeting as part of their role e.g. budgeting for research grant applications, raising POs etc.
  • central finance staff who are not VAT experts but have to deal with VAT on transactions, such as Accounts Receivable staff raising invoices, and Accounts Payable staff processing invoices.

It is therefore useful to a very broad range of staff across the whole university.

Of course it is also useful to anyone working in tax who is either new to the role, new to a university setting, new to tax, or just looking for a refresher of some of the basics.

Introducing VAT in HE is part of the BUFDG Pro subscription service, so anyone (in any department) of a BUFDG Pro subscribing university can access this module for free – anyone who doesn’t yet have a BUFDG log in can register for a normal web log in or a ‘quick registration’ e-learning log in here.

The module covers:

  • An overview of VAT
  • VAT on income (including overseas supplies)
  • VAT on purchases (including from overseas)
  • VAT on budgeting
